A new project for Archewell Productions: Duchess Meghan is working on an animated family series for Netflix.

In addition to the documentary series “Heart of Invictus”, Archewell Productions by Prince Harry (36) and Duchess Meghan (39) is now also working on another series for the streaming service Netflix. This is reported, among other things, by the industry magazine “Variety”. It is therefore an animated series with the working title “Pearl”.

Duchess Meghan will not only be the creator of the family series, but will also work as an executive producer – together with David Furnish (58), Carolyn Soper, Liz Garbus (51), Dan Cogan and Amanda Rynda, who also appears as a showrunner.

What “Pearl” should be about

The production is described as “a family series centered around the adventures of a twelve-year-old girl who is inspired by a host of influential women from history.” Duchess Meghan explains in a statement: “Like many girls her age, our heroine Pearl is on a journey of self-discovery while she tries to master the daily challenges of life.”

Film producer Furnish, also known as the spouse of megastar Elton John (74), is also delighted with the project, with which, according to a statement, he and Duchess Meghan “bring the inspiring and positive stories of extraordinary women around the world to a global audience of all ages “want to bring closer. It is currently not known when the series will appear.
